Effective September 1, 2008, any 1, 2, or 3 family dwelling within Summit County General Health District (SCGHD) served by a household sewage treatment system and/or a private water system, must have an inspection on each system before the property can transfer ownership.    Homes with a septic system must have a service provider, registered with SCGHD, or a SCGHD sanitarian conduct the evaluation prior to transfer.   Inspections on private water systems must be conducted by a private water system contractor, registered with the Ohio Department of Health, or a SCGHD sanitarian.  A printable list of inspectors able to perform point of sale inspections is available by clicking on the Inspectors link to the left.

Sellers who wish to have the SCGHD perform the point of sale inspection must submit an application to the Health District for these services.  A printable application is available by clicking the Point of Sale Inspection Application link to the left.  To receive an application by mail or fax, please call the Environmental Health front desk at 330-926-5600.  Currently the SCGHD charges $325.00 to inspect the household sewage treatment system and private water system combined, $230 to inspect the household sewage treatment system only, and $175 to inspect the private water system only.  Inspections are performed on a first come first served basis.  Inspections are typically performed Monday through Thursday between 8:00 a.m. and 3:00 p.m.  SCGHD usually schedules the inspections within a few days after the application is received.

If a private company is used to conduct the point of sale inspection, registered service providers and private water system contractors will submit copies of inspection reports to the SCGHD for review.  The SCGHD will review the report and issue the private company a certificate of review.
